'Personal Settings' cannot load
my computer has a problem after i accidently kicked the power bar while the computer said 'Loading Personal Settings...'. so now when i login, it says something about 'cannot load profile' and now it has a folder named TEMP in the Documents and Settings folder which has me reconfigurating every setting back, but the worst part is that it doesn't save the setting and everything i logon the popip says the profile could not be loaded and it uses TEMP again. is there a way to fix this problem because since it screwed up, i have longer loading times and everything is unconfigured like its a new account.
EDIT: now im trying system restore and see how that works, ill come back and notify you guys (great thx in advance)
EDIT2: WOOHOO!! system restore fixed my problem. (mod please close)
